Single Mother in NSW Receives Over $800 in Refunds: A Guide for Eligible Parents A single mother from New South Wales recently shared her experience of receiving over $800 in refunds for her car registration and driver's license fees. She discovered that as a single parent, she was eligible for significant financial assistance. "I just saved over $800!" she exclaimed in a recent video, explaining that she made a simple phone call to claim the money back. The woman's story highlights the potential for single parents in NSW to access similar financial benefits. She encourages others to check their eligibility through Service NSW.
